Thunder Hill Raceway ready for ‘KTSA Night at the Races’

 

Kyle, TX (August 29, 2006) - The regular season comes to a close Saturday night at Thunder Hill Raceway (THR) – and the track has a media partner to celebrate.

 

KTSA-AM radio (San Antonio) will join the drivers, crews, families and fans this Saturday (Sept. 2) at the 3/8-mile paved oval in Kyle as the Texas Super Racing Series (TSRS) Late Models run the 550-KTSA 75, the A-Line Auto Parts Street Stocks run the A-Line Auto Parts 50 and the great folks at A-Line Auto Parts/Arnold Oil Company of Austin will present a fan favorite – the A-Line Auto Parts Demolition Derby.

 

Racing starts at 7 p.m. with the Demo Derby to follow. The purse is expected to climb up to $1,500 for the winner with only a $50 entry fee. For more information on the Derby, folks can call 512.393-9471 and 512.262.1352. The rules are posted at the track’s web site, www.thunderhillraceway.com.

 

A-Line Auto Parts and THR will combine to host the Big Brothers, Big Sisters visitors at the track that night.

 

Fans attending the exciting night will also see great racing action from the Texas Pro Sedans, the THR Hobby Stocks, THR Grand Stocks, Lonestar Legacys and the NASKARTS. The JRA Kids Club will host its fan favorite – the Kids Bike Races – during intermission and will give one lucky JRA Kids Club member a ride in a limousine provided by the fine folks at Racing Limos of Austin and All Tranz Transmission Repair of Austin.

 

K-MAC Sports Productions will interview the top three finishers in the A-Line Auto Parts Street Stocks 50 on during its online broadcast of the race. “We will run the NASKARTS races between the Street Stocks race and the 550-KTSA 75 so the Street Stocks drivers can get some time during the broadcast,” said THR co-owner Mary Ann Naumann. “We know a lot of people who come to see the races live like to hear the replay of the broadcast on the web site, www.kmacsports.com, so it’s only appropriate to give the Street Stocks drivers their due.”

 

Admission for this Saturday’s racing action is just $18 for adults, $7 for children ages 6-12; kids under 6 years old get in free. There is a $2 discount for senior citizens, police and military personnel.

 

Announcements and information about Thunder Hill Raceway can be found at the track’s web site, www.thunderhillraceway.com or by calling the track’s hot line at 512.262.1352. Thunder Hill Raceway is located at Exit #210 off IH-35 North in Kyle (TX).
